James Thompson updates advisers on the FCA's social media guidance and outlines how to drive business value by keeping it simple

LinkedIn, Facebook, Twitter and YouTube are just a few of the social networks that financial advisers in the UK are embracing in ever-increasing numbers. But are these socially savvy advisers also sure of the business value social media affords? And is there a protocol to follow? The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has recently published its finalised guidance on using social media for promoting services, attempting to clarify the rules for advisers to follow.
